Dorsey, the 205 series tires may be way too small for OEM appearance and size.

IIRC, I had some 205 series Goodyear Arrivas installed; great tires; non-directional tread pattern, but, boy, were they tiny.

If it's not too late, try to find out what the riding height of your 205-tires may be.

We want our tires to approximate 28" in height .
